Output 095c8e55baa8d3439b6e355c78e4408cd7409f66417d670104043434c708a1f7:0

value
505568478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ecd66f7de3d3722e53cb3a06de6a020f925d8c0 OP_EQUAL
address
3HdHZX33rUY7USKGtSLoTNEfTJVV9WkoZ9
transaction
095c8e55baa8d3439b6e355c78e4408cd7409f66417d670104043434c708a1f7
spent
true